用于soc平台上进行gptp对时的pps秒脉冲信号输出方法及系统
基本信息
申请号 | CN202010691652.X | 申请日 | - |
公开(公告)号 | CN111884746A | 公开(公告)日 | 2020-11-03 |
申请公布号 | CN111884746A | 申请公布日 | 2020-11-03 |
分类号 | H04J3/06(2006.01)I;H04L12/26(2006.01)I | 分类 | 电通信技术; |
发明人 | 文小军;穆国强 | 申请(专利权)人 | 爱瑟福信息科技(上海)有限公司 |
代理机构 | 上海远同律师事务所 | 代理人 | 爱瑟福信息科技(上海)有限公司 |
地址 | 201207上海市浦东新区自由贸易试验区郭守敬路351号2幢428室 | ||
法律状态 | - |
摘要
摘要 | 一种用于soc平台上进行gptp对时的pps秒脉冲信号输出方法,包括:一、获取当前时间的纳秒值;二、调用基于ptp时钟的睡眠函数进行睡眠,睡眠结束后,执行步骤三;三、获取当前时间的纳秒值;四、若所述期望纳秒值‑所述纳秒值=电平建立时间±x,则向soc芯片的GPIO端口输出电平,返回步骤一,当所述期望纳秒值为500000000ns时,电平为低电平,当所述期望纳秒值为1000000000ns时,电平为高电平,所述电平建立时间为所述soc芯片的出厂标定参数,否则,返回步骤三。本发明提供了一种以软件程序的方式实现且精度能到达要求的pps秒脉冲信号的输出方法,使信号的输出不依赖于硬件,适用面广。 |
